Local News in Brief : ‘Tall Man’ Suspect Held in 18 Bank Robberies

A bandit dubbed “The Tall Man” because of his height was arrested Friday in connection with 18 recent bank robberies in the San Fernando Valley, Los Angeles police said.

In the robberies, committed during the last two months, the 6-foot, 5-inch suspect would present a demand note to the teller, then stuff the cash into a clutch purse, Lt. Bruce Meyer said. The man never showed a gun and no car was ever seen, officers said.

Howard H. Ghammaghami, 23, of Reseda, was arrested as he drove in the Van Nuys area and was being held in lieu of $6,000 bail in County Jail on suspicion of armed robbery, police said.

Police would not disclose how much money the bandit took.
